Questions and Answers
What is the cheapest way to get from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ims?
The cheapest way to get from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ims is to rideshare which costs $7.61 - $10.33 and takes 1h 49m.
What is the fastest way to get from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ims?
The fastest way to get from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ims is to drive which takes 1h 4m and costs $19.57 - $29.35 .
Is there a direct bus between Val d'Europe (Station) and Reims?
No, there is no direct bus from Val d'Europe (Station) station to Reims. However, there are services departing from Chessy South Bus Station and arriving at Gare Centre via Gare Champ. Tgv.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 45m.
Is there a direct train between Val d'Europe (Station) and Reims?
No, there is no direct train from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ims. However, there are services departing from Val d'Europe and arriving at St Thomas via Marne La Vallee Chessy and Gare Champ. Tgv.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 5m.
How far is it from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ims?
The distance between Val d'Europe (Station) and Reims is 123 km. The road distance is 112.7 km.
How do I travel from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ims without a car?
The best way to get from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ims without a car is to train and subway which takes 2h 5m and costs $31.52 - $65.22 .
How long does it take to get from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ims?
It takes approximately 2h 5m to get from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ims, including transfers.
Where do I catch the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ims bus from?
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ims bus services, operated by BlaBlaCar Bus, depart from Chessy South Bus Station.
Where do I catch the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ims train from?
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ims train services, operated by TGV inOui, depart from Marne La Vallee Chessy station.
Train or bus from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ims?
The best way to get from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ims is to bus and line 07 bus which takes 2h 45m and costs $13.04 - $20.65 . Alternatively, you can train, which costs $38.04 - $76.09 and takes 2h 31m.
Where does the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ims bus arrive?
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ims bus services, operated by BlaBlaCar Bus, arrive at Reims - Champagne Ardenne Train Station.
Where does the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ims train arrive?
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ims train services, operated by TGV inOui, arrive at Champagne-Ardenne station.
Can I drive from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ims?
Yes, the driving distance between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ims is 113 km. It takes approximately 1h 4m to drive from Val d'Europe (Station) to Reims.
